Les Miserables is not about the original French Revolution of 1789. It describes a student revolution in June, 1832.

Instead of writing out the name of a city, Victor Hugo sometimes just listed the first letter: D________ or M_______ sur M____ Why do you think he would do this?
18
D________ is the city of Digne M________ sur M_____ is Montreuil sur Mer Toulons Prison
